Donald, James Edward was born on April 20, 1949 in Jackson, Mississippi, United States.
Bachelor in Political Science and History, University Mississippi, 1970. Master of Public Administration, University Missouri, 1983. Graduate, Command General Staff College.
Graduate, National War College.
Commissioned 2nd lieutenant United States Army Infantry, 1970, advanced through grades to major general, battalion adjunct/commander C Company 1st Battalion, 87th Infantry Regiment Baumholder, Germany, infantry advisor Readiness Group Stewart New York, inspector general, inspection team chief 101st Airborne Division Fort Campbell, Kentucky, battalion executive officer 2d Battalion, 502d Infantry Regiment, battalion Commander 1st Battalion, 502d Infantry Regiment, chief forces team War Plans division, Office Deputy Chief Staff, Commander 1st Brigade, 101st Airborne division, chief military support division, deputy director operations/JE United States Pacific Command Camp Smith, Hawaii, assistant division Commander operations 25th Infantry Division Schofield Barracks. Deputy commanding general United States Army Pacific, Fort Shafter, 1998—2000. Deputy chief of staff over personnel and installations (retired) United States Army Forces Command, Fort McPherson, Georgia, 2000—2003.
Corrections commissioner Georgia Department of Corrections, Georgia State Governor, Atlanta, since 2003.
Married August S. Green. Children: Jeff, Cheryl.
